Dhanush's NEEK to release in February

NEEK marks his third directorial, while he is filming his fourth Idli Kadai

Actor Dhanush's directorial Nilavukku En Mel Ennadi Kobam (also called NEEK) has set a Valentine's week release in 2025.

The makers announced on Wednesday that the film, billed as a romantic drama, will be releasing in theatres on February 7 next year. It was also announced that Red Giant Movies has acquired the distribution rights of the film in Tamil Nadu.

Two singles from the film—'Golden Sparrow' and 'Kadhal Failu'—were dropped earlier.

NEEK features Pavish, Anikha Surendran, Priya Prakash Varrier, Matthew Thomas, Venkatesh Menon, Rabiya Khatoon, and Ramya Ranganathan in pivotal roles.

GV Prakash Kumar, who composed Dhanush's Aadukalam, Asuran, Polladhavan, Vaathi, and Captain Miller, is scoring the music for NEEK, while Leon Britto has been roped in as the cinematographer and GK Prasanna will handle the cuts.

Dhanush was last seen in Raayan, his 50th film as an actor and second as a director. NEEK marks his third directorial, while he is filming his fourth Idli Kadai, which will be releasing on April 10, 2025.
